Resource Round Up: No one should navigate the child welfare system alone. Join us for Resource Round Up, a dedicated space where foster and kinship parents gather to share advice, process the emotional waves of fostering, and trade vital community resources. Come for the practical tips, stay for the community.
Topic: From that trendy sound your child loves to the filter they can’t get enough of, you probably know that social media apps are a fun tool for expressing yourself and staying in the know—and you also might know that they can be risky. This class will provide a roadmap for parents to teach their children how to have a safer social media experience.
